Selecting the Right Extensions
The first step in optimizing your workflow is to identify Chrome extensions that align with your specific needs. Here are some popular categories to consider:
- Task Management: Extensions like Todoist and Asana help you keep track of tasks and deadlines.
- Time Tracking: Tools such as Harvest and Clockify allow you to monitor the time spent on various projects.
- Note-Taking: Evernote and Google Keep extensions enable quick capture of thoughts and ideas directly from your browser.
- Content and SEO Tools: Use extensions like Grammarly for writing and MozBar for SEO analysis to improve your content quality.
- Automation: Tools like Zapier and IFTTT can automate repetitive tasks and connect different applications seamlessly.
Installing Chrome Extensions
Once you’ve identified the extensions you need, installing them is simple:
- Open the Chrome Web Store.
- Search for the desired extension.
- Click on the “Add to Chrome” button.
- Select “Add extension” in the popup to confirm installation.
After installation, the extension icon will appear in your Chrome toolbar, allowing for easy access.
Managing Your Extensions
It’s important to manage your extensions effectively. Having too many active extensions can slow down your browser and impact performance. Here’s how to manage them:
- Access your extensions by navigating to chrome://extensions/ in your browser.
- Disable or remove any extensions that you don’t actively use.
- Regularly update your extensions to ensure they function optimally.
Leveraging Extensions for Workflow Optimization
Once you have your Chrome extensions installed and managed, utilize them in ways that enhance your workflow:
- Set up notifications: Use task management extensions to set reminders for deadlines and important tasks.
- Automate repetitive tasks: Use automation extensions to create workflows that save time on routine activities.
- Utilize shortcuts: Familiarize yourself with keyboard shortcuts for your extensions to speed up your processes.
- Integrate with other apps: Many extensions allow integration with other tools you use, like calendars and email, to create a seamless workflow.
